In case of force majeure, Chairman of the Thai Football Federation (FAT) Somyot is willing to give this organization an interest-free loan.

As information, the Thai Football Federation has fallen into a staggering situation when the budget shortage is serious. This results the delayed tournaments and the Thai team having no money to prepare for the upcoming international tournaments.

Mr. Somyot Poompanmuang said in an interview: "I met Mr. Aiyawat Srivaddhanaprabha, CEO of King Power Group (which owns Leicester City club) to talk about Thai football situation.

Currently FAT is short of money to organize competitions including Thailand. Mr. Aiwat promised not to abandon Thai football and will help, but how will be detailed later.

When asked if he would take his money to help FAT, the Chairman did not hesitate: "It is a matter of my plan.

In case I can't find help because in the past, I used family money to lend FAT to solve work. I also went to talk to my friends and they found people who will help the Thai football industry, to continue to grow.

It is expected that the Thai League will return next September, while Thailand will focus earlier this month. However, Nishino found it difficult to return to Thailand because there was no entry flight from Japan. The Thai Football Federation had to ask the Government for permission to allow Mr. Nishino to enter as a special case.
